    Role Overview

    We are seeking experienced AI Architects to join a centralized AI Center of Excellence (CoE), responsible for driving enterprise-wide AI transformation. This role focuses on embedding agentic AI into delivery models and the end-to-end SDLC, while defining governance, standards, and scalable AI frameworks in a highly regulated environment. The architect will act as a strategic authority and hands-on leader, ensuring consistent, secure, and high-quality AI implementations across client-facing and internal platforms.

    Key Responsibilities

    AI-Driven SDLC Transformation

    Design AI-first delivery models across requirements, development, testing, and deployment. Integrate AI agents into DevOps/CI-CD pipelines and define measurable productivity KPIs (cycle time, defect reduction, velocity).

    Agentic AI Architecture

    Design and implement multi-agent systems using frameworks like LangChain, AutoGen, and CrewAI.

    Define agent patterns (planner-executor, tool-using agents, critic loops) and ensure observability, explainability, and guardrails.

    AI Platform & Framework Development

    Build reusable accelerators, playbooks, and reference architectures. Establish standards for prompt engineering, RAG, model selection, and evaluation. Enable self-service AI platforms using cloud ecosystems like Amazon Web Services and Microsoft Azure.
